Delivery Postie with Driving
Job reference: 328121
Location: Luton Delivery Office, LU1 1AA
Job type: Permanent contract
Hours: 30:00 hours per week, working 4 days across Wednesday – Saturday, working between 08.30 and 14.30

Due to operational demand, you will be required to work during the weekends.

What we do for you

To deliver on our ambition we want the best and that\’s why we\’re delighted to offer competitive pay and benefits for a permanent role within our sector. For bringing your best and serving our customers with pride, you can expect to receive:

A guaranteed hourly rate ofΒ£12.54p/h (paid monthly and adjusted to your working hours).
Paid overtime, with an enhanced rate of x1.25 for any hours worked over 40 hours a week.
22.5 days holiday, rising with length of service (adjusted to your working hours if below 40 hours a week) and the option to buy extra leave each year.
Full uniform provided
Company pension scheme with competitive contribution rates
Lots of opportunity to develop a career, including our trainee manager roles and Apprentice Schemes
Excellent family friendly support – enhanced maternity pay, paternity leave, adoption leave and shared parental leave
Your Wellbeing – you and your family have 24/7 free access to services and tools to help support your physical and mental health, including financial and social support and advice
Various discounts including high street vouchers, travel and attraction discounts, and savings on beauty products and gym membership
Free stamps at Christmas

Please note: For candidate search purposes, roles offering between 35-40 hours per week are listed as full-time. However, any role under 40 hours per week will be classified as part-time in the employment contract.

How to prepare for a job interview at Royal Mail Group

✨Show Your Community Spirit

As a Postperson, you'll be delivering to your local community. Highlight your connection to the area and any previous experience in customer service or community engagement. This will show that you care about the people you serve.

✨Demonstrate Reliability and Punctuality

Being organised and punctual is crucial for this role. Be prepared to discuss how you manage your time effectively and ensure that deliveries are made on schedule, even in challenging conditions.

✨Emphasise Your Physical Fitness

This job involves a lot of walking and working outdoors, so it's important to convey your readiness for a physically demanding role. Share any relevant experiences that demonstrate your ability to stay active and fit.

✨Prepare for Weekend Work

Since the role requires weekend work, be ready to discuss your availability and willingness to work during these times. Showing flexibility can set you apart from other candidates.
